Bug 1156742 Part 1: Change Moz2D recording, so that it can be used in isolation. r=bas These are mainly changes to make sure we have recorded relevant dependencies to each draw operation. Where we can't record them on the fly like this, it makes sure the object has originated from our DrawTarget.

# -*- Mode: python; c-basic-offset: 4; indent-tabs-mode: nil; tab-width: 40 -*-
# vim: set filetype=python:
# This Source Code Form is subject to the terms of the Mozilla Public
# License, v. 2.0. If a copy of the MPL was not distributed with this
# file, You can obtain one at http://mozilla.org/MPL/2.0/.

DIRS += ['components', 'atoms']

JAR_MANIFESTS += ['jar.mn']